Brechtel19826 Feb 2018 4:30 a.m. PST

The following may be of help in this area:

-The End of Empire: Napoleon's 1814 Campaign by George Nafziger.

-Napoleon: Against Great Odds by Ralph Ashby.

-Memoirs of the Invasion of France by Baron Fain.

-Napoleon and the Campaign of France, 1814 by Henry Houssaye.

James Lawford's Napoleon: The Last Campaigns: 1813-1815 is seconded.

1814 is also covered very well in the Esposito/Elting Atlas.

These will also be helpful:

-Napoleon et des Allies sur le Rhin by Lefebvre de Behaine.

-No Peace with Napoleon by Armand Caulaincourt.
